OverviewMIPEX-05 PPM [C3H8] is a high-performance NDIR gas sensor in a 4th series housing with 10 ppm resolution. It is a high-sensitivity, ultra-low power infrared sensor designed to detect propane (C3H8) at low concentrations (from ~30 ppm), enabling early leak detection and emission/health-safety monitoring. The sensor supports measurement in both ppm and LEL concentrations and is optimized for battery-powered portable detectors due to its very low power consumption.

ULTRA-LOW POWER CONSUMPTIONAverage power consumption below 0.3 mW.
INTEGRATED MICROCONTROLLERReturns linearized and temperature-compensated digital output via UART interface.
TECHNOLOGYSimultaneous control of ppm and LEL concentrations. Dual-wavelength technology minimizes interference from water vapor and contamination, ensuring high measurement reliability.
Explosion-proof designIntrinsically safe explosion protection level "ia" in compliance with IECEx, ATEX, UL913, CSA.
Standard 4th series sizeDurable plastic housing Ø20.1 × 16.6 mm for easy integration.
LONG-TERM MEASUREMENT STABILITYDesigned for long-term measurement stability over 10 years.

Characteristics / technical specifications- Model family: MIPEX-05
- Sensor principle: NDIR (infrared), dual-wavelength
- Target gas: Propane (C3H8) — ppm and LEL measurement
- Resolution: 10 ppm
- Lowest detection / recommended detection start: from ~30 ppm (propane)
- Average power consumption: below 0.3 mW (ultra-low power)
- Output: Digital, linearized and temperature-compensated via UART
- Explosion protection: Intrinsically safe level "ia" (IECEx, ATEX, UL913, CSA)
- Housing: 4th series, durable plastic, dimensions Ø20.1 × 16.6 mm (standard 4th series size)
- Long-term stability: Designed for >10 years stability
- Integration: Suitable for battery-powered and portable detectors
